Bnei Eilat Football Club (Hebrew: מועדון כדורגל בני אילת) is an Israeli football club based in Eilat.
[2] In their first season of existence, the club won Liga Gimel South-Central division and promoted to Liga Bet.
[3] In the 2009–10 season, the club won Liga Bet South B division with a margin of 14 points, and promoted to Liga Alef.
The following season, was the best season in the club history, after they finished third in Liga Alef South, and qualified for the promotion play-offs, where they lost 2–3 to Maccabi Kabilio Jaffa, after a late goal.
